#db5079 - Rose Turkish Delight color

A vivid rose-mauve that sits between coral and fuchsia, offering a lush balance of warmth and vibrancy. It reads as energetic yet refined, bold enough to command attention while retaining a romantic softness. Ideal for fashion accents, cosmetic palettes, and modern branding, it pairs beautifully with deep charcoal, cream, or pale mint for contrast. Use it to convey confidence, creativity, and youthful elegance—especially effective in feminine designs, packaging, and accent walls where a lively, stylish mood is desired.

#db5079 color RGB value is 219, 80, 121, and the CMYK value is 0.00, 0.635, 0.447, 0.141. Alternative names for that color are: rose turkish delight, brown, palevioletred, cranberry, blush, violet.
